Message type: E = Error
Message class: FSH_MSG_CL_VAS - Message Class for Value Added Services
Message number: 015
Message text: Entered application field name not in the mapping structure fsh_icom

- Entered application field name not in the mapping structure fsh_icom ?The SAP error message FSH_MSG_CL_VAS015 indicates that there is an issue with the mapping of application field names in the context of the VAS (Value-Added Services) functionality within SAP. Specifically, it suggests that the field name you have entered is not recognized in the mapping structure
fsh_icom
.Cause:
- Incorrect Field Name: The field name you are trying to use may be misspelled or does not exist in the mapping structure.
- Mapping Structure Issues: The mapping structure
fsh_icom
may not be properly configured or may not include the field you are trying to reference.- Configuration Errors: There may be issues in the configuration of the VAS settings or the related application components.
- Version Compatibility: The field may not be available in the version of SAP you are using, or it may have been deprecated.
Solution:
- Verify Field Name: Double-check the field name you are entering to ensure it is spelled correctly and exists in the mapping structure.
- Check Mapping Structure: Review the mapping structure
fsh_icom
to confirm that the field you are trying to use is included. You can do this by navigating to the relevant configuration settings in SAP.- Configuration Review: Go through the VAS configuration settings to ensure everything is set up correctly. This may involve checking the customizing settings in transaction SPRO.
- Consult Documentation: Refer to SAP documentation or help resources to understand the expected field names and their mappings.
- SAP Notes: Check for any relevant SAP Notes that may address this specific error or provide updates regarding the mapping structure.
- Contact Support: If the issue persists, consider reaching out to SAP support for assistance, especially if you suspect a bug or a deeper configuration issue.
